Claims (15)
- 락테이트, 3-하이드록시부티레이트 및 중간사슬길이(MCL)의 3-하이드록시알카노에이트를 반복단위로 함유하는 3-하이드록시부티레이트-MCL 3-하이드록시알카노에이트-락테이트 삼중합체 [poly(3-hydroxybutyrate-co-MCL 3-hydroxyalkanoate-co-lactate)].
- 제1항에 있어서, 상기 MCL의 3-하이드록시알카노에이트는 3-하이드록시헥사노에이트 (3-hydroxyhexanoate, 3HHx), 3-하이드록시헵타노에이트 (3-hydroxyheptanoate, 3HHp), 3-하이드록시옥타노에이트 (3-hydroxyoctanoate, 3HO), 3-하이드로노나노에이트 (3-hydrononanoate, 3HN), 3-하이드록시데카노에이트 (3-hydroxydecanoate, 3HD), 3-하이드록시운데칸노에이트 (3-hydroxyundecanoate, 3HUD) 및 3-하이드록시도데카노에이트 (3-hydroxydodecanoate, 3HDD)로 구성된 군에서 선택되는 것을 특징으로 하는 공중합체.
- 락테이트(lactate)를 락틸-CoA(lactyl-CoA)로 전환하고 3-하이드록시알카노에트(3-hydroxyalkanoate)를 3-하이드록시알카노일-CoA(3-hydroxyalkanoyl-CoA)로 전환하는 효소의 유전자 및 폴리하이드록시알카노에트(polyhydroxyalkanoate:PHA) 합성효소 유전자를 동시에 가지는 세포 또는 식물을 배양 또는 재배하는 것을 특징으로 하는 3-하이드록시부티레이트-MCL 3-하이드록시알카노에이트-락테이트 삼중합체 [poly(3-hydroxybutyrate-co-MCL 3-hydroxyalkanoate-co-lactate)] 의 제조방법.
- 제3항에 있어서, 상기 MCL의 3-하이드록시헥사노에이트 (3-hydroxyhexanoate, 3HHx), 3-하이드록시헵타노에이트 (3-hydroxyheptanoate, 3HHp), 3-하이드록시옥타노에이트 (3-hydroxyoctanoate, 3HO), 3-하이드로노나노에이트 (3-hydrononanoate, 3HN), 3-하이드록시데카노에이트 (3-hydroxydecanoate, 3HD), 3-하이드록시운데칸노에이트 (3-hydroxyundecanoate, 3HUD) 및 3-하이드록시도데카노에이트 (3-hydroxydodecanoate, 3HDD)로 구성된 군에서 선택되는 것을 특징으로 하는 방법.
- 제3항에 있어서, 세포 또는 식물은 상기 두 유전자를 모두 가지지 않는 세포 또는 식물을 락테이트(lactate)를 락틸-CoA(lactyl-CoA)로 전환하고 3-하이드록시알카노에트(3-hydroxyalkanoate)를 3-하이드록시알카노일-CoA(3-hydroxyalkanoyl-CoA)로 전환하는 효소의 유전자와 lactyl-CoA를 기질로 사용하는 PHA 합성효소의 유전자로 형질전환하여 수득되는 것임을 특징으로 하는 방법.
- 제3항에 있어서, 세포 또는 식물은 락틸-CoA(lactyl-CoA)를 기질로 사용하는 PHA 합성효소의 유전자를 가지는 세포 또는 식물을 락테이트(lactate)를 락틸-CoA(lactyl-CoA)로 전환하고 3-하이드록시알카노에트(3-hydroxyalkanoate)를 3-하이드록시알카노일-CoA(3-hydroxyalkanoyl-CoA)로 전환하는 효소의 유전자로 형질전환하여 수득되는 것임을 특징으로 하는 방법.
- 제3항에 있어서, 세포 또는 식물은 락테이트(lactate)를 락틸-CoA(lactyl-CoA)로 전환하고 3-하이드록시알카노에트(3-hydroxyalkanoate)를 3-하이드록시알카노일-CoA(3-hydroxyalkanoyl-CoA)로 전환하는 효소의 유전자를 가지는 세포 또는 식물을 lactyl-CoA를 기질로 사용하는 PHA 합성효소의 유전자로 형질전환하여 수득되는 것임을 특징으로 하는 방법.
- 제3항에 있어서, 상기 락테이트(lactate)를 락틸-CoA(lactyl-CoA)로 전환하고 3-하이드록시알카노에트(3-hydroxyalkanoate)를 3-하이드록시알카노일-CoA(3-hydroxyalkanoyl-CoA)로 전환하는 효소의 유전자는 프로피오닐-CoA 트랜스퍼라아제 유전자(pct)인 것을 특징으로 하는 방법.
- 제3항에 있어서, 폴리하이드록시알카노에트(polyhydroxyalkanoate:PHA) 합성효소 유전자는 슈도모나스 속(Pseudomonas sp.) 6-19 유래의 phaC1ps6 -19인 것을 특징으로 하는 방법.
- 제3항에 있어서, 폴리하이드록시알카노에트polyhydroxyalkanoate:PHA) 합성효소 유전자는 서열번호 7의 아미노산 서열에서 E130D, S325T 및 Q481M가 변이된 아미노산 서열을 코딩하는 유전자인 것을 특징으로 하는 방법.
- 제3항에 있어서, 세포 또는 식물은 3-하이드록시알카노에트(3-hydroxyalkanoate)를 3-하이드록시알카노일-CoA(3-hydroxyalkanoyl-CoA)로 전환하는 효소의 유전자를 추가로 함유하는 것을 특징으로 하는 방법.
- 제11항에 있어서, 상기 3-하이드록시알카노에트(3-hydroxyalkanoate)를 3-하이드록시알카노일-CoA(3-hydroxyalkanoyl-CoA)로 전환하는 효소는 α-케토티올레 이즈(PhaA) 또는 아세토아세틸-CoA 리덕테이즈(acetoacetyl-CoA reductase: PhaB)인 것을 특징으로 하는 방법.
- 제3항에 있어서, 세포는 미생물인 것을 특징으로 하는 방법.
- 제13항에 있어서, 미생물은 대장균인 것을 특징으로 하는 방법.
- 제3항에 있어서, 배양 또는 재배는 3-하이드록시부티레이트(3-HB) 및MCL 3-하이드록시알카노에이트(MCL 3-HA)를 함유하는 환경에서 수행되는 것을 특징으로 하는 방법.
